This petition was rejected

The Government e-Petitions Team gave the following reason:

There's already a petition about this issue. We cannot accept a new petition when we already have one about a very similar issue.

You are more likely to get action on this issue if you sign and share a single petition.

The age at which women are offered cervical screening is not set out in law, but we have published the following petition, which you might like to sign:

Make Cervical Screening available to everyone from the age of 21: petition.parliament.uk/petitions/580043
